How much do remote fall marketing internship j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ote fall marketing internship in the United States is $17.08,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Autism Speaks is seeking an Events Intern in Columbus, Ohio for the Fall semester! This is a 10-week remote program, and students must be eligible for academic credit. This is an opportunity for an individual to gain valuable event planning experience. As a member of the development team, the intern will have the opportunity to assist in the planning and execution of Columbus, Ohio area events. Area Events include Walk, 5k Run, Summit, Third Party event support and other miscellaneous events. At the end of this internship, the Events Intern will have working knowledge of key event skills, including developing event timelines, planning processes, and community outreach which they will be able to translate into future career opportunities.
The Events Intern will report to the Director, Community Engagement. The ideal candidate should be looking to gain experience in Non-Profit Special Events for future work. The intern will receive necessary training and staff supervision.
This is a remote position, but applicant must live in Central Ohio area and have access to transportation to attend events or meetings if needed.
DUTIES:
  • Assist with planning logistics across Columbus, Ohio
  • Assist with planning and outreach of kickoff events
  • Assist with donor, sponsor, and volunteer outreach and stewardship
  • Assist with area marketing and communications, including but not limited to email and social media content drafting
  • Assist with silent auction donation and in-kind partnership outreach
  • Provide administrative support and perform job-related tasks as assigned
QUALIFICATIONS:
  • Pursuing a bachelor's degree.
  • Able to receive academic credit
  • Commitment to a flexible work schedule of 20 hours per week during standard business hours
  • Superior organizational and communication skills
  • Strong attention to detail and a demonstrated ability to take initiative
  • Excellent customer service skills in dealing with internal and external constituents
  • Must have the ability to work with a team
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ications, Social Media Technology
